- [ ] Step 7: Archive cold storage buckets (Glacierline tier). Confirm both ceremony witnesses are present, verify bucket manifests match the Oxbow ledger, then seal the archive key shares. Plugin authors may observe but not handle shares. Once sealed, the archive index itself is encrypted and can only be reopened with the passphrase below.

vault phrase of badup-hahig = tamael-aldael-kelmir-istael-fenok-istwyn-tamius-jorath-oliion

Subject: On-call basics — Parchmint loyalty ledger

Welcome aboard. Key points: the ledger is append-only; never edit rows directly. Points discrepancies go through the reconciliation job, which runs hourly. If it fails twice, page the ledger owner — don't retry manually. Alerts come through the standard channel. The runbook, escalation steps, and reconciliation flags are all on the on-call page.

wiki page, tahaf-tajog: https://jira.ordindyn.corp/pipeline

Handover — Pressfold incremental rebuilds

Quick context for on-call: Pressfold regenerates only the pages whose source content changed, using the dependency graph cached in the Tarnwick store. Last week we bumped the graph schema, so any node older than build 412 triggers a full rebuild — that's expected, not an incident. If rebuild times spike past twenty minutes, check the invalidation queue depth first; it usually means the cache warmer on the Dunmere box stalled. To restart the warmer safely, it needs these configuration values:

config for bahop-fajep:
DRUATH_PIN=4501
DRUATH_TENANT=briwyn
DRUATH_METRICS_HOST=metrics.druath.brasksoft.test
DRUATH_SEAL=seal_7d2e069d
DRUATH_STANDBY_TEAM=olieth